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 3.0 (http://www.flasher.ru/forum/forumdisplay.php?f=83)
-   -   Как массив превратить в параметры передаваемые методу? (http://www.flasher.ru/forum/showthread.php?t=132814)

lak-n-roll 20.11.2009 20:01

Как массив превратить в параметры передаваемые методу?
 
Здравствуйте!
Столкнулся с проблемой.
Есть массив состоящий из переменных различных типов: int, Boolean...
И есть метод в который нужно передать праметры этого самого массива.
Ar[0][1] это и есть участок массива с параметрами для метода.

Так не получается:
Код AS3:

GoGoGo(Ar[0][1]); // насколько я понял, Ar[0][1] автоматически превращается в строку.

Есть ли какой нибудь выход из ситуации? Или единственный выход, это уже в самом методе разобрать массив? Этого не хотелось бы делать, потому как метод универсальный, и каждый раз передавать туда параметры в виде массива не очень удобно.
Заранее благодарен.

cursed_man 20.11.2009 20:34

если правильно понял вопрос, то
Код AS3:

GoGoGo.apply(this,Ar[0][1]);


lak-n-roll 20.11.2009 21:12

Большое спасибо! Всё заработало!


Часовой пояс GMT +4, время: 04:43.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2026,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.